Abstract
Disclosed is a nitrogen oxide reduction device using dielectric barrier discharge plasma. The plasma nitrogen oxide reduction device may limitedly emit nitrogen oxide with a form of NO 2 at a final outlet of the plasma nitrogen oxide reduction device by arranging a combustion unit, a wet treatment unit, and a plasma oxidizing unit in a housing. The emitted nitrogen oxide is finally treated in a wet scrubber operated as a reducer at a final exhaust end.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1 . An energy saving-type DBD plasma nitrogen oxide reduction device configured to treat waste gas, comprising:
a combustion unit combusting the waste gas; a wet treatment unit configured to receive the combusted gas from the combustion unit and perform wet treatment on the gas; and a plasma oxidizing unit arranged to insert plasma gas for treating nitrogen oxide included in the gas passing through the wet treatment unit.
2 . The device of claim 1 , further comprising a housing, wherein the combustion unit, the wet treatment unit, and the plasma oxidizing unit are arranged in the housing.
3 . The device of claim 2 , further comprising a main emission tube configured to emit the nitrogen oxide, treated by the plasma gas, to outside of the housing, wherein the plasma oxidizing unit is connected and mounted to a connection path connected to the main emission tube in the housing.
4 . The device of claim 1 , wherein the plasma gas is O 3 generated through plasma discharge of the plasma oxidizing unit.
5 . The device of claim 4 , wherein the nitrogen oxide is converted into NO 2 by oxidizing with O 3 generated in the plasma oxidizing unit.
6 . The device of claim 5 , wherein the converted NO 2 is treated through a reduction reaction in a wet treatment process which is a post treatment process.
7 . The device of claim 1 , wherein the plasma oxidizing unit comprises a rod-shaped internal electrode, a dielectric configured to surround the internal electrode, and an external electrode inserted and mounted into an outer part of the dielectric in a coil form, wherein the internal electrode and the external electrode are applied with alternating current power for generation of plasma.
8 . The device of claim 7 , wherein the external electrode has a surface coated with thermal spraying.
9 . The device of claim 7 , wherein an external surface of dielectric and an external surface of external electrode are formed at the same height.
